Sorry for the paleo post but curious if there was ever a resolution for
this issue regarding BDR member join/eject:

https://goo.gl/N7FoUB

I'm currently seeing very similar behavior for the latest version of BDR
where cluster nodes are very confused about the state of their
connections/replication slots when a new node joins with a completely
different local_node_name but same IP address as previous cluster member.
